Build Quality Checklists For 2026 Workstation Pcs

As technology advances rapidly, ensuring the quality of your 2026 workstation PCs is essential for maintaining performance, reliability, and user satisfaction. A comprehensive build quality checklist helps technicians and engineers verify every critical component during assembly and testing phases.

Key Components to Inspect

  • Motherboard: Check for proper installation, no bent pins, and secure connections.
  • Processor: Verify compatibility, correct seating, and thermal paste application.
  • Memory Modules: Test for correct insertion, stability, and capacity.
  • Storage Devices: Confirm proper connection, formatting, and performance benchmarks.
  • Graphics Card: Ensure proper seating, power connection, and driver compatibility.
  • Power Supply Unit (PSU): Test for voltage stability and sufficient wattage.

Physical Inspection Checklist

  • Check for physical damage or defects on all components.
  • Ensure all screws and fasteners are secure.
  • Verify cable management for airflow and safety.
  • Inspect cooling systems, including fans and heatsinks, for proper installation.

Performance and Stability Testing

  • Run diagnostic tools to check CPU, GPU, and RAM health.
  • Perform stress tests to evaluate thermal performance and stability.
  • Test all ports and interfaces for functionality.
  • Verify network connectivity and speed.

Software and Firmware Verification

  • Update BIOS/UEFI firmware to the latest version.
  • Install necessary drivers and verify their operation.
  • Configure system settings for optimal performance.
  • Run security scans and install security patches.

Final Quality Assurance Checks

  • Perform a visual inspection for cleanliness and proper assembly.
  • Verify all documentation and labeling are accurate.
  • Conduct a final performance benchmark test.
  • Record all test results and any issues found for future reference.
